Great Sy Oliver arrangement--ever since he wrote it, it's hard not to hear influences of it in later recordings. It's interesting listening to Sinatra during this period. He had a more youthful, boyish style. Later in the 40s he adopted more of a baritone and an almost operatic style. Then in the 50s it was his swinging singing and reflect ballad style (the voice I usually think of as Sinatra's) and of course, his later voice, which was at first, deeper in tone and then later, when let's face it, his tone and timbre pretty much gone, but he still had that innate sense of excellent phrasing.
